Is It Okay for Reese Pro Weight Distribution System 49903 To Have Different Spring Bars
Question:
I have a Pro Series #49903 that came with a trailer I bought. One spring bar is bent approximately 1 so both are not the same so there is different chain links on both sides. Does this affect towing? 2018 F150 5 1/2 ft. Bed.
asked by: Don C
Expert Reply:
I can't exactly recommend using a weight distribution system with different spring bars because if the system is not providing an even amount of pressure on both sides, it could very well lead to issues like sway, porpoising, etc. Unfortunately, this system is discontinued and replacement parts like the spring bars are no longer available. Therefore, the only options we'd be able to offer is a new system, the Curt MV Weight Distribution System part # C17052 which has the same 1,000 lb capacity.
